IGNOU Passing Marks for Assignments

Assignments are a crucial component of IGNOU’s assessment system. They typically account for 25% to 30% of the total grade in a course. Assignments are evaluated based on various factors such as completeness, accuracy, and clarity.

2.2 Minimum Passing Marks for Assignments

To pass an assignment, students are typically required to obtain a minimum of 40% marks. This is true for both semester-based assignments and yearly assignments.

Students who do not achieve the minimum required score in the assignment must re-submit the assignment or contact the relevant department.

2.3 How to Submit Assignments

Assignments must be submitted according to the instructions provided in the course materials. Most assignments can be submitted either online via the IGNOU portal or offline at the study centers.

  • Online Submission: Through the official IGNOU portal.
  • Offline Submission: At the designated study centers before the deadline.

IGNOU Passing Marks for Theory Exams

Theory exams form the largest portion of the overall assessment at IGNOU. They are usually held at the end of each semester or academic year, depending on the program.

3.1 Weightage of Theory Exams

Theory exams typically account for 70% to 75% of the total marks, depending on the specific program. These exams test the student’s understanding of the subjects covered in the course and contribute significantly to the final grade.

3.2 Minimum Passing Marks for Theory Exams

To pass a theory exam, students must obtain at least 40% in the theory exam.

It’s essential to note that the minimum passing score for the theory exam is usually 40% in both the individual paper and overall. Students who fail to achieve the minimum passing score will need to reappear for the exam during the next available session.

3.3 How to Prepare for Theory Exams

Here are some tips for effectively preparing for IGNOU’s theory exams:

  • Know the Syllabus: Refer to the syllabus for the specific topics and chapters covered in the exam.
  • Prepare Notes: Make notes of key concepts, formulas, and important definitions.
  • Solve Previous Years’ Papers: Solving past papers can help familiarize you with the exam pattern.
  • Time Management: Create a study timetable to cover all the subjects and topics efficiently.
  • Practice Writing: Practice writing long answers and essays to improve your writing speed and articulation.

IGNOU Passing Marks for Practical Exams

For certain programs, especially in the fields of science, engineering, and vocational studies, practical exams are an essential component. These exams are conducted in a supervised setting where students demonstrate their understanding and practical knowledge of the course material.

4.1 Weightage of Practical Exams

Practical exams generally account for 25% to 30% of the total grade, depending on the course.

4.2 Minimum Passing Marks for Practical Exams

To pass the practical exam, students typically need to secure 40% of the total marks allotted for the practical exam.

Overall Passing Criteria for IGNOU Programs

To successfully pass an IGNOU program, students must meet the minimum passing criteria in all components—assignments, theory exams, and practical exams (if applicable).

5.1 Aggregate Passing Score

Students must secure an aggregate score of at least 40% across all components of the course. This includes the assignments, theory exams, and practical exams.
